TO DO ANY AND ALL THINGS IN CONNECTION WITH THE OPERATION AND MANAGEMENT OF AN AQUARIUM AND PROVIDING, MAINTAINING, AND ENCOURAGING THE USE OF QUALITY PUBLIC FACILITIES AND WORKS WHICH WILL OFFER SCIENTIFIC RESEARCH, EDUCATIONAL, AND RECREATIONAL OPPORTUNITIES FOR THE BENEFIT OF THE PUBLIC AND MAINTAINING AND CARING FOR A VARIED AND EXTENSIVE INVENTORY OF AQUATIC LIFE IN A HUMANE, HEALTHY, AND SANITARY ENVIRONMENT FOR A HIGH QUALITY OF LIFE FOR SUCH AQUATIC LIFE.

Top pay as a share of expenses
In 2024, the highest total compensation at MISSISSIPPI AQUARIUM equaled 2% of the organization's total expenses. The median for animal-related organizations is 8%.
Based on 3,692 animal-related organ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.

Climbed 14%
over 2 years
From $198k in 2022 to $226k in 2024.
Estimated with BLS CPI-U for the South region, restating filed pay into May 2026 dollars. A restatement of past pay, not current or projected pay.
Chief Executive Officer pay rose 14% from 2022 to 2024, while revenue rose 28%.
- Chief Financial Officer pay rose 1% from 2023 to 2024.
- Board Vice President pay rose 1% from 2023 to 2024.
Pay for the position itself, not any one person. The officeholder may have changed between 2022 and 2024.

Common questions about MISSISSIPPI AQUARIUM
What does the Chief Executive Officer of MISSISSIPPI AQUARIUM earn?
In 2024, the Chief Executive Officer of MISSISSIPPI AQUARIUM received $226,350 in total compensation. This pay is in the top 10% for Chief Executive Officer roles among Animal-Related organizations nationwide: at least 9 in 10 comparable filings report less. Based on IRS Form 990 data.
How does Chief Executive Officer pay at MISSISSIPPI AQUARIUM compare with similar nonprofits?
Compared with the same role at Animal-Related organizations nationwide, the 2024 pay of the Chief Executive Officer at MISSISSIPPI AQUARIUM falls in the top 10%. In 2024, the highest total compensation at MISSISSIPPI AQUARIUM equaled 2% of the organization's total expenses. The median for animal-related organizations is 8%.
What are MISSISSIPPI AQUARIUM's revenue and expenses?
In 2024, MISSISSIPPI AQUARIUM reported $8.7M in total revenue and $10.2M in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
